An Introduction to Neurodivergence and the Cultural Sector

This event will provide delegates with a clear understanding of The Neurodiversity Movement, current legislation underpinning neurodivergent access and adjustments, information around neurodiversity terminology, and, crucially, a greater confidence in developing neurodivergent programming, provision and workforce.
